The Detroit Pistons (12–2) released their latest injury report ahead of their matchup against the Atlanta Hawks (9–5), listing star guard Cade Cunningham as questionable with a left hip contusion. Detroit enters the contest on a league-best 10-game win streak and begins a four-game road trip Tuesday night.

Cunningham has not played since the Pistons’ 137–135 overtime win against the Washington Wizards on Nov. 10. In that victory, the 24-year-old delivered one of the most dominant performances of his career, finishing with 46 points, 12 rebounds, 11 assists, five steals and two blocks while logging 45 minutes. He shot 14-for-45 from the field, 2-for-11 from three and 16-for-18 at the free throw line.
